Comprehending UPVC: Material Properties and Advantages

UPVC sticks out from traditional window and door products due to its unique structure and amazing performance qualities. Unlike standard PVC, which consists of plasticizers that make it versatile, UPVC goes through a manufacturing process that removes these ingredients, leading to a rigid, long lasting product that maintains its structural integrity under varying environmental conditions. This rigidness forms the foundation of UPVC's outstanding thermal insulation residential or commercial properties, as the product does not expand and contract considerably with temperature level fluctuations.

The advantages of UPVC extend far beyond its insulating capabilities. Homeowners who set up UPVC windows and doors frequently notice immediate enhancements in their home's energy effectiveness, as the multi-chambered profiles develop thermal barriers that decrease heat transfer. In an era of rising energy expenses, this translates to considerable cost savings on heating & cooling expenses over the lifespan of the setups. Pre-Installation Planning and Considerations

Effective UPVC door window setup starts long before the actual fitting process starts. House owners must thoroughly assess their existing openings, taking accurate measurements to guarantee proper fitment. The measurement process involves recording the width and height at multiple points, as existing openings might not be perfectly square. Professional installers typically measure the narrowest point in each dimension and subtract a small clearance space to accommodate squaring and sealing throughout setup.

Building policies represent another important consideration in the planning phase. Current UK building policies stipulate minimum thermal efficiency standards for replacement doors and windows, generally needing a U-value of 1.4 W/m ² K or much better for windows. homeowners planning to carry out UPVC setup ought to confirm whether their task falls under allowed development rights or requires official planning consent, particularly for homes in conservation areas or listed structures. Consulting with regional building control authorities before commencing work ensures compliance and prevents costly modifications down the line.

The Professional Installation Process

Specialist UPVC door window setup follows a systematic method created to maximize efficiency and longevity. The process begins with the cautious removal of existing doors and windows, which should be performed without harming the surrounding brickwork or structural aspects. Installers safeguard interior home furnishings and flooring with dust sheets and protective coverings before starting work.

The brand-new UPVC frame shows up on-site, generally with the glass units currently installed in windows, though some homeowners prefer separate shipment for site-glazing. Installers position the frame within the opening, utilizing packers to achieve ideal alignment and ensure the frame sits square. Checking positioning with spirit levels at numerous points prevents concerns with operation and sealing that occur from frames that run out true. Once positioned properly, installers secure the frame through pre-drilled fixing points, utilizing expansion bolts or frame screws proper to the substrate.

The lasts of installation involve using quality silicone sealant around the boundary to create a weather-tight seal, installing any necessary trim pieces or cladding, and guaranteeing all hardware operates efficiently. Expert installers adjust hinges and locks to make sure simple and easy operation and optimum security. The whole process for a common window takes between one and 2 hours, while door installations may require 2 to 3 hours depending on intricacy.

Expense Breakdown and Value Analysis

Comprehending the monetary aspects of UPVC door window installation helps property owners budget appropriately and assess quotes from prospective installers. The following table offers normal expense varieties for common window and door sizes, inclusive of supply and professional setup but omitting VAT.

Setup Type

Common Size

Expense Range (₤)

Average Installation Time

Standard Window

1200mm × 1200mm

400 - 600

1.5 - 2 hours

Large Window

1800mm × 1200mm

700 - 1,000

2 - 2.5 hours

Patio Door

1800mm × 2100mm

1,200 - 1,800

3 - 4 hours

Front Door

900mm × 2100mm

800 - 1,400

2 - 3 hours

French Doors

1800mm × 2100mm

1,400 - 2,000

3 - 4 hours

These figures represent typical market rates, and actual costs vary based upon geographic location, installer experience, picked hardware specs, and glass type. House owners ought to obtain numerous quotes and validate that each consists of removal of existing units, disposal, and proper guarantees.

Necessary Maintenance for Longevity

Keeping UPVC windows and doors effectively guarantees years of trusted service with very little intervention. Regular cleansing with a moderate detergent and soft cloth removes accumulated dirt without harming the UPVC surface area or protective finishings. Homeowners ought to avoid abrasive cleaners, scouring pads, and solvent-based items, which can scratch or discolour the product.

Hardware maintenance should have particular attention, as hinges, manages, and multi-point locking systems need routine lubrication to run efficiently. Applying a light silicone-based lubricant to moving parts every year prevents tightness and wear. Monitoring and adjusting the compression on door and window seals assists keep ideal weatherproofing performance, particularly after the first year of installation when preliminary settlement happens.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does UPVC door window setup generally take?

The period varies based on the number of systems and project intricacy. A single window installation usually takes between one and two hours, while a door setup requires 2 to 3 hours. Multi-unit jobs typically proceed at a rate of 2 to 3 windows daily for an expert setup team.

Can UPVC windows be set up in older residential or commercial properties with uneven walls?

Expert installers accommodate unequal walls through cautious measurement and making use of packaging materials that permit frames to be positioned completely square. The versatility of sealing systems utilized in modern UPVC installation accommodates small variations in wall positioning without jeopardizing weatherproofing.

Do UPVC installations include assurances, and what do they cover?

Trusted installers provide guarantees varying from 5 to 20 years, covering both the UPVC profiles and the installation craftsmanship. Glass units typically carry different maker assurances against seal failure. homeowners must obtain written guarantee terms before starting work and validate that the installer provides insurance-backed protection.

Is expert installation essential, or can competent DIYers undertake UPVC setup?

While skilled DIYers can carry out UPVC setup, expert installation provides significant benefits consisting of guaranteed workmanship, compliance with structure guidelines, and access to boosted security features that require specialist understanding. Complex door installations, particularly those involving multi-point locking systems, advantage most from expert proficiency.

How quickly can I expect energy cost savings after setting up UPVC doors and windows?

Houses typically observe improved thermal convenience immediately following setup, with measurable energy savings appearing on the first quarterly energy bill after installation. The full monetary advantage collects over the first year as residents adjust their heating and cooling habits to the improved thermal efficiency.
